What does Blackshark.ai do?
Blackshark.ai generates a real-time, accurate, semantic, and photorealistic 3D digital twin of the entire planet using machine learning and satellite imagery. The platform processes over 100 TB of daily input to convert raw sensor imagery into structured digital representations of the physical world.
What problem does Blackshark.ai solve?
Blackshark.ai addresses the problem of processing the vast amount of data generated by the physical world, which exceeds the capacity of human organizations. It claims to process only 1% of available data today, leaving 99% as lost insights.
What features or components does the Blackshark.ai platform include?
The platform includes several key components: HUNTR™ for AI-driven detection and extraction of infrastructure, VEOS™ for distributed processing of trillions of pixels, and REPLIKA™ for reconstructing the physical world into simulation-ready 3D environments. It offers deployable infrastructure across cloud, sovereign on-premise, and edge systems.
Who is the target audience for Blackshark.ai?
Blackshark.ai is an AI infrastructure platform targeted at developers and enterprises requiring foundational geospatial intelligence. It provides developer tools and platform services for building applications that interact with the physical world.
What are some performance specifications mentioned for the platform?
A reference deployment using a 100x NVIDIA H100 GPU cluster can process 7 million square kilometers per day, analyze trillions of pixels, and extract 100 million infrastructure objects.
What is Blackshark.ai used for?
It is used for creating simulation-ready 3D environments, geospatial analytics, AI training, and visualization. The platform provides operational environments for exploration, planning, and spatial analysis.
